On any given night you’ll see Chin Chin-style lines outside Fitzroy North’s Moroccan Soup Bar. The reason? This tiny venue that boasts no menu, no booze and no meat, has managed to garner legendary status amongst northside locals for its epic vegetarian spread that’s both delicious and cheap.
If you bring your own Tupperware, you can even get your Soup Bar feed takeaway. It’s a stellar deal, and owner Hana Assafiri knew it. Now, Hana has opened another venue down the road that will service all those takeaway orders.
Instead of the vegetarian banquet, takeaway diners at Moroccan Soup Bar Two Go can get a variety of rice and couscous dishes, lentil dhal, chilli tahini bake, housemade pickles and Soup Bar’s famous chickpea bake for $12.50. If you bring your own containers, you’ll get it for $10.50.
More reasons to love Two Go include the fact that it’s open for lunch and you can order online. They’ve even added new items to their takeaway menu, including Moroccan-spiced flatbreads called marrakizzas which will be topped with various veggo toppings. As usual, they are very accommodating to dietary requirements with both vegan and gluten-free options.
Moroccan Soup Bar Two Go is open at 316 St Georges Road, Fitzroy North from Tuesday to Sunday 11am-3pm and 5.30-9.30pm.
